发明名称 |
Record-time optimization of display lists |
摘要 |
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for optimizing a display list. Graphics processing commands are identified for generation of one or more graphical images on a computer device. During an initial recording of a graphics display list to include the graphics processing commands, if a sub-list of the display list is determined to not include any drawing commands, the display list is recorded so that commands on the sub-list are not executed when the display list is executed. |
申请公布号 |
US9336555(B1) |
申请公布日期 |
2016.05.10 |
申请号 |
US201213656624 |
申请日期 |
2012.10.19 |
申请人 |
Google Inc. |
发明人 |
Guy Romain P. |
分类号 |
G06T1/00 |
主分类号 |
G06T1/00 |
代理机构 |
Fish & Richardson P.C. |
代理人 |
Fish & Richardson P.C. |
主权项 |
1. A computer-implemented method comprising:
receiving, by one or more computers, graphics processing commands for generation of one or more graphical images on a computer device; as each graphics processing command is received, during a record time when a graphics display list is initially generated, and before any compiling of the graphics display list occurs:
determining whether each graphics processing command is not a drawing command, andinitially recording the graphics display list, by the one or more computers, for later execution so that a sub-list of particular commands that are determined to not be drawing commands are not executed when the display list is executed, by the particular commands being indicated as non-executing or being discarded; and executing the display list for generation of the one or more graphical images. |
地址 |
Mountain View CA US |